MRIGlobal is seeking an experienced Director Accounting-Controller to lead the organization's accounting and financial reporting functions and serve as a key financial leader within the organization.
Reporting to the Chief Financial Officer and Treasurer, the Director Accounting-Controller oversees the Accounting Department and provides the technical expertise, financial insight, and leadership necessary to support MRIGlobal's financial strength and stability.
This is an opportunity for a seasoned accounting leader who combines deep technical accounting knowledge with sound business judgment, a strategic perspective, and experience working in a government contracting or similarly regulated environment. The successful candidate will lead a significant accounting function, strengthen financial processes and controls, partner with leaders across the organization, and help ensure the integrity and reliability of MRIGlobal's financial information.
What You'll Lead
Financial Reporting, Government Accounting & Compliance Lead the preparation of accurate and timely financial statements in accordance with generally accepted accounting principles (GAAP). Ensure compliance with applicable accounting standards, regulations, and reporting requirements, with particular attention to the requirements and complexities associated with government contracting and federally funded work. Support internal and external auditors throughout the annual audit process.
Financial Analysis & Decision Support Provide financial analysis, insight, and recommendations that help senior leadership make informed business decisions. Apply a strong understanding of accounting and financial principles to evaluate performance, identify trends and risks, and support organizational financial objectives.
Internal Controls & Risk Management Establish and maintain a strong system of internal controls that safeguards organizational assets and promotes compliance with policies and applicable regulatory requirements. Identify and mitigate financial risks through proactive risk management.
Budgeting & Forecasting Lead the budgeting and forecasting process in partnership with department leaders. Develop accurate and realistic financial plans, monitor budget performance, and provide meaningful variance analysis to identify opportunities for improvement.
Accounting Leadership & Talent Development Lead and develop a high-performing Accounting team, fostering collaboration, accountability, and professional growth. Build departmental capabilities through effective systems, processes, and talent development, while maintaining strong relationships with internal partners and suppliers. The position manages five direct reports and 14 indirect staff.
Process Improvement Evaluate and continuously improve accounting and financial processes to streamline workflows, increase efficiency, and strengthen the effectiveness of financial systems and tools. Identify opportunities to improve processes while maintaining appropriate accounting controls and compliance requirements.
Cash Management & Tax Compliance Manage cash flow and liquidity to ensure the organization can meet its financial obligations. Implement effective treasury management practices and work with tax advisors to develop tax strategies and ensure compliance with applicable tax laws and regulations.
What You'll Bring
Minimum Qualifications
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related field and 15 years of progressively responsible accounting or financial management experience.
Minimum of 5 years of experience in a senior accounting, controller, or financial management role.
Strong knowledge of GAAP, financial reporting, internal controls, and regulatory compliance.
Experience with government contractor accounting, including FAR, CAS, Uniform Guidance, indirect cost rates, incurred cost submissions, and audit support.
Experience with Deltek Costpoint, financial reporting tools, and accounting system modernization initiatives.
CPA designation required.
